What is Startup India?

The Startup India initiative, launched on January 16, 2016, seeks to revolutionize India’s startup landscape by focus on innovation and entrepreneurship. Pune startups can avail various schemes to scale operations and engage with cutting-edge technologies or innovative service models. Through simplified regulatory measures and broadening funding access pathways, the initiative aims to boost domestic and international market success.

Administered by DPIIT

The Department for Promotion of Industry and Internal Trade (DPIIT) oversees the Startup India initiative. This department plays a pivotal role in recognizing startups based on eligibility criteria, issuing Startup Recognition Certificates, and ensuring seamless access to benefits like tax exemptions. DPIIT continuously works with other government departments to refresh policies creating an enabling environment for startups.

Eligibility Criteria for Startup India 2025

For Pune-based startups, who seek DPIIT recognition and the accompanying benefits, the following eligibility criteria must be met:

  • The entity must be incorporated as a private limited company, LLP, or partnership firm.
  • The business should not exceed 10 years from the date of incorporation.
  • The annual turnover should be under INR 100 crores in any financial year post-establishment.
  • The entity must demonstrate innovation, leveraging technology or intellectual property.
  • Must acquire the Startup India certificate from DPIIT.
  • All legal compliance, as outlined by the Companies Act and similar regulations, needs to be adhered to.
  • Opportunities for job creation should be a key business element.

Who Is Not Eligible for Recognition?

It is crucial that aspiring startups in Pune understand the exclusions under the Startup India initiative:

  • Sole proprietorships are not considered eligible.
  • Partnership firms not registered officially are disqualified.
  • Businesses crossing the INR 100 crore turnover threshold will not qualify.
  • Entities older than 10 years cannot claim recognition.
  • Split or reconstituted enterprises won't be considered innovative.

Documents Required for Certificate

To apply for a Startup India certificate and gain DPIIT recognition, these documents are necessary:

  • MoA & AoA or Partnership Deed to define company objectives and partner responsibilities.
  • Certificate of Incorporation as proof of legal business establishment.
  • PAN Card of the organization for financial identity.
  • PAN Card of the authorized signatory for compliance purposes.
  • Aadhaar card of the authorized person for identity verification.
  • Business address proof to establish location credibility.
  • Up-to-date bank statement proving the business's financial status.
  • Photographs of directors or partners for official records.

Details Required for Application

While applying for Startup India recognition in Pune, certain key details must be furnished:

  • Official name of the startup.
  • Organization type, e.g., Private Limited Company, LLP, or Partnership Firm.
  • Company's PAN number for unique identification.
  • Active email address for communication.
  • Mobile contact number for verification.
  • Name of the authorized signatory representing the startup.
  • Personal PAN number of the authorized person for identity.
  • Business address alongside city, state, and pin code details.
  • GST registration status of the company.

Certification Benefits

Recognition under Startup India presents several advantages:

  • Entitlement to a 100% tax exemption over three financial years under Section 80-IAC.
  • Exemption from angel tax for eligible investment conditions.
  • Substantial rebates on patent and trademark registrations.
  • Self-certification of compliance for reduced legal interference.
  • Access to government tenders and procurement opportunities.
  • Participation in national and international networking events.
  • Enhanced funding prospects through the Fund of Funds for Startups.

To qualify for Startup India in Pune, your business must be a private limited company, LLP, or registered partnership firm, less than 10 years old, with annual turnover under INR 100 crores. It must also demonstrate an innovative approach.
Businesses in Pune can enjoy tax exemptions, enhanced funding opportunities, simplified compliance regulations, and network through government-organized events once recognized under the Startup India initiative.
Startup India is not limited to specific sectors; it supports a wide range of industries aiming for innovation and entrepreneurship, making it highly relevant for the diverse economic landscape of Pune.
Key documents needed include the Certificate of Incorporation, PAN cards, partnership deeds if applicable, business address proof, bank statements, and details about the company and its authorized signatory.
No, sole proprietorships are not eligible for Startup India. The initiative requires your business to be a registered entity like a private limited company, LLP, or partnership firm.
Pune startups recognized under Startup India may access funding from the government-backed Fund of Funds, which collaborates with SEBI-registered venture capital firms.
Yes, recognized startups in Pune can benefit from income tax exemptions for three consecutive years within their first ten years of operation under the Startup India scheme.
Startups in Pune should focus on innovative products, processes, or services with significant use of technology or intellectual property to meet DPIIT recognition criteria under Startup India.
No, businesses that were incorporated more than 10 years ago are not eligible for Startup India recognition regardless of their location, including Pune.
Startups in Pune must register through the Startup India portal, followed by applying for DPIIT recognition via the National Single Window System to access the benefits such as funding and exemptions.
